We almost always have crackers and shredded cheese in the house. Just those two ingredients. That’s all you need. The more plain the crackers the better.

I’ve tried a low fat shredded cheese once that didn’t have a lot of flavor on its own, so I added just a wee bit of garlic salt on top. If your cheese lacks a punch, give that a try.

For your own sanity, please take heed to my warning and don’t leave these crackers unattended under the broiler.

Melted Cheese Crackers Recipe

    20 Servings

Ingredients

  • Plain Crackers
  • Your Favorite Shredded Cheese

Directions

  1. Preheat your oven on broil setting.
  2. Line a baking sheet with a silicone baking sheet or parchment paper.
  3. Place a single layer of crackers on the baking sheet.
  4. Sprinkle with shredded cheese.
  5. Place under the broiler for a couple minutes. I do not recommend walking away.
  6. Remove when cheese is melted.
  7. Serve alongside your favorite dip or by themselves in a bowl!
